Pipe

DEFINITION

Any tube that produces sound when air is forced through it. The organ employs a series of pipes to produce sound; horns and woodwinds employ a single pipe. An end-blown flute with three finger holes, usually played with a drum called a tabor. A bagpipe.Generic term for hollow tube or cylinder that forms part of a wind instrument. Sound is produced when air vibrates within the pipe. more specifically, a small, simple fipple flute is often called a pipe.
